INTERNATIONAL NEWS DISTRIBUTORS, INC. v. SHRIVER

No. 73-1184.

488 F.2d 1350 (1973)

INTERNATIONAL NEWS DISTRIBUTORS, INC., Plaintiff-Appellant, v. Thomas H. SHRIVER, District Attorney General for the Tenth Judicial Circuit, and Richard P. McCully, Assistant District Attorney General for the Tenth Judicial Circuit, Defendants-Appellees.

United States Court of Appeals, Sixth Circuit.

Decided December 19, 1973.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Gilbert H. Deitch, Atlanta, Ga., for plaintiff-appellant; Larry D. Woods, Nashville, Tenn., Robert Eugene Smith, Baltimore, Md., on brief.

C. Hayes Cooney, Asst. Atty. Gen. of Tenn., Nashville, Tenn., for defendants-appellees; David M. Pack, Atty. Gen. of Tenn., Nashville, Tenn., of counsel.

Before EDWARDS, and LIVELY, Circuit Judges, and CECIL, Senior Circuit Judge.


LIVELY, Circuit Judge.

The issue before the court on appeal is whether the district judge properly dismissed that portion of an action seeking a declaratory judgment that certain statutes of Tennessee are unconstitutional as written and applied and seeking to enjoin enforcement of the statutes in question.
